ucc: Unitary Compiler Collection
The Unitary Compiler Collection (UCC) is a Python library for frontend-agnostic, high performance compilation of quantum circuits.
UCC interfaces automatically with multiple quantum computing frameworks, including Qiskit, Cirq, and PyTKET and supports programs in OpenQASM 2 and OpenQASM 3. For a full list of the latest supported interfaces, just call ucc.supported_formats.

Quickstart
Installation
git clone https://github.com/unitaryfund/ucc.git
cd ucc
pip install -e . # Editable mode
Example with Qiskit, Cirq, and PyTKET
Define a circuit with your preferred quantum SDK and compile it!
from ucc import compile
from pytket import Circuit as TketCircuit
from cirq import Circuit as CirqCircuit
from qiskit import QuantumCircuit as QiskitCircuit
from cirq import H, CNOT, LineQubit
def test_tket_compile():
circuit = TketCircuit(2)
circuit.H(0)
circuit.CX(0, 1)
compile(circuit)
def test_qiskit_compile():
circuit = QiskitCircuit(2)
circuit.h(0)
circuit.cx(0, 1)
compile(circuit)
def test_cirq_compile():
qubits = LineQubit.range(2)
circuit = CirqCircuit(
H(qubits[0]),
CNOT(qubits[0], qubits[1]))
compile(circuit)

Benchmarking
You can benchmark the performance of ucc against other compilers using scripts/run_benchmarks.sh. This script runs compiler benchmarks in parallel, so you will need to first install parallel to support it.
On Mac you can do this with brew install parallel.

License
UCC is distributed under GNU Affero General Public License version 3.0(AGPLv3). Parts of ucc contain code or modified code that is part of Qiskit, which is distributed under Apache 2.0 license.
